Claudia Hale

Claudia Hale, 89, Wilkesville, passed away at her residence surrounded by her family January 1, 2013. She was born August 30, 1923, in Varney, Kentucky, daughter of the late John and Tanney Case Williamson.

She married John B. Hale August 23, 1941, in Pikeville, Kentucky, and he preceded her in death March 24, 1998. Also preceding was grandson, Ronnie A. Hale; a very special daughter-in-law, Susie Hale; four sisters and one brother, Norma, Doris, Jettie, Nadene and Donnie Hale.

Mrs. Hale is survived by three sons, Claude (Martha) Hale, Langsville, Ohio; William (Patricia) Hale, St. Amant, Louisiana, and John Elliott (Jane) Hale, Jackson, Ohio, and two daughters, Karen Hale Elliott, Wilkesville, Ohio, and Katrena Hale-Claver, North Redington Beach, Florida; fifteen grandchildren, twenty three great-grandchildren, and one great-great-grandchild; two brothers and two sisters, Isaac (Billie Joyce) Williamson, Lonnie Williamson, and Lena (Billy) Webb, all of Varney, Kentucky, and Lucille (Wade) Bostic, Charleston, South Carolina; a host of nieces and nephews.

She was a member of Maggie’s Home Old Regular Baptist Church, Dundas, Ohio, where funeral services will be held at 11 a.m. Tuesday, January 8, 2013, with Brothers Don Mullins, Greg Sowards and Johnny Thornsberry officiating. Burial will follow in the Vinton Memorial Park. Friends may call at the McCoy-Moore Funeral Home, Vinton Chapel, on Monday from 4-6 p.m. with funeral services from 6-8 p.m.

If preferred, memorial gifts will be accepted for Maggie’s Home Church by the McCoy-Moore Funeral Home, Vinton, Ohio 45686-0148.
